Workers’ compensation
This contractor has certified to the state that they have no employees, so they carry no workers’ compensation policy. The exemption covers only the license holder. If anyone else works on your project — a crew, a helper, a day laborer — they are not covered, and an injury on your property can become your liability. Ask who will physically be on site.
